In October, the average temperature in Redwood, United States hovers around 11°C (52°F), with minimums plunging to -3°C (26°F) and maximums rising to 26°C (80°F). Be prepared for 160 mm (6.3 in) of precipitation over 14 days, and expect an average humidity of a cozy 83%.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
